Plywood is the material for volumes with planar faces. Organic shapes are mostly made of glass fibre. More recently, some manufacturers have been heat molding thermoplastic sheet material&#8230;<br><br>I created an algorithm to quickly design and explore plywood volumes. At the push of a button, plans or data can be exported for cutting with hand tools or 5-axis CNC machines. With production always being incredibly challenging and big source of frustration, I came to the conclusion it is not worth investing my time into a product which some major players in the business still cut with 3-axis CNC machines and manually operated table saws or even handheld circular saws. The result might be accurate but the manual process is not what I want it to be.
